Synopsis

This was the first book to define urban guerrilla warfare as a political and military technique. It assessed all the most prominent urban guerrilla groups of its time, their effect to that date and their chances for the future. It provides detailed case studies of the IRA in Northern Ireland, the FLQ in Quebec, the Weathermen in the United States, the Brazilian guerrilla groups and the Tupamaros in Uruguay.
